SSIS适配器助力Power BI REST API数据操作
需积分: 9 139 浏览量
更新于2024-11-12
收藏 7.26MB ZIP 举报
资源摘要信息:"SSISAdapterForPowerBI:用于 Power BI REST api 的 SSIS 适配器"
知识点概述:
1. SSIS 适配器:SSIS(SQL Server Integration Services)是一个用于数据抽取、转换和加载(ETL)的平台,是Microsoft SQL Server数据集成解决方案的一部分。适配器是一种软件组件,可以连接并集成不同的数据源和目标,SSIS 适配器用于增强SSIS的功能,使其能够与特定数据源或服务进行交互。
2. Power BI REST API:Power BI 是 Microsoft 提供的商业智能服务,允许用户创建仪表板和报告,以可视化形式展现数据。REST API(Representational State Transfer Application Programming Interface)是一种软件接口,允许系统之间进行通信,通常基于HTTP协议。Power BI REST API 允许用户通过HTTP请求操作Power BI服务中的数据和资源。
3. 与 Power BI REST API 相关的操作:
- 创建新的数据集和表:在 Power BI 中,数据集是由相关数据表构成的集合,用于支持报告和分析。SSIS适配器允许通过REST API在Power BI中创建新的数据集和表。
- 获取所有数据集的列表:此功能可以列出当前在Power BI服务中的所有数据集,有助于用户了解和管理其Power BI内容。
- 将新记录插入表中:通过SSIS适配器,可以在Power BI的数据集中插入新的数据记录。
- 从表中删除所有记录:此功能允许用户清空Power BI中的特定数据表。
4. 类型映射:类型映射是指在不同的系统之间转换数据类型的过程。在SSIS适配器与Power BI REST API交互时,需要将SSIS中的数据类型转换为Power BI REST API能够理解和处理的数据类型。文档中提到了一些SSIS和Power BI中的数据类型映射,例如:
- SSIS中的 DT_STR 类型对应于Power BI中的字符串类型。
- SSIS的 DT_R4 和 DT_R8 类型对应于Power BI中的浮点类型。
- SSIS的 DT_UI1 到 DT_UI8 类型对应于Power BI中的无符号整型。
- SSIS的 DT_I1 到 DT_I4 类型对应于Power BI中的有符号整型。
- SSIS的 DT_DATE, DT_DBTIMESTAMP, DT_WSTR 等类型分别对应于Power BI中的日期、时间戳和字符串类型。
5. 技术栈和编程语言:根据标签"C#",可以推断该适配器的开发语言为C#。C#是一种由微软开发的面向对象的编程语言,广泛应用于.NET框架中。这表明SSIS适配器可能是基于.NET平台开发的。
6. 压缩包子文件的文件名称列表:"SSISAdapterForPowerBI-master":这表明适配器的代码或文件可能包含在一个名为“SSISAdapterForPowerBI-master”的压缩包中。"master"通常指代源代码仓库中的主分支,意味着这个压缩包可能包含适配器的最新或稳定版本。
7. 可用性与局限性:从描述中得知,当前的SSIS适配器仅限于执行上述的特定操作,这表明其功能可能较有限,并且可能正在开发中或尚未完全实现。随着时间的推移和开发的深入,可能会支持更多的Power BI REST API功能。
总结:该适配器为开发人员提供了一种将SSIS与Power BI通过REST API进行交互的方式,尽管目前功能有限,但为处理特定类型的数据操作提供了一定程度的便利性。随着进一步的开发,预期该工具的功能将得到增强,以满足更复杂的业务需求。
2021-12-10 上传
2021-03-08 上传
2021-02-05 上传
2014-05-14 上传
2022-04-24 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
tafan
- 粉丝: 41
- 资源: 4652
最新资源
- 黑板风格计算机毕业答辩PPT模板下载
- CodeSandbox实现ListView快速创建指南
- Node.js脚本实现WXR文件到Postgres数据库帖子导入
- 清新简约创意三角毕业论文答辩PPT模板
- DISCORD-JS-CRUD:提升 Discord 机器人开发体验
- Node.js v4.3.2版本Linux ARM64平台运行时环境发布
- SQLight:C++11编写的轻量级MySQL客户端
- 计算机专业毕业论文答辩PPT模板
- Wireshark网络抓包工具的使用与数据包解析
- Wild Match Map: JavaScript中实现通配符映射与事件绑定
- 毕业答辩利器:蝶恋花毕业设计PPT模板
- Node.js深度解析:高性能Web服务器与实时应用构建
- 掌握深度图技术:游戏开发中的绚丽应用案例
- Dart语言的HTTP扩展包功能详解
- MoonMaker: 投资组合加固神器,助力$GME投资者登月
- 计算机毕业设计答辩PPT模板下载